SI5350C-B01863-GT operates based on the principle of frequency synthesis, where it generates clock signals by combining multiple phase-locked loops (PLLs) and dividers.
In communication systems, SI5350C-B01863-GT can be used for timing synchronization, clock distribution, and frequency generation in transceivers, base stations, and network switches.
For test and measurement equipment, SI5350C-B01863-GT provides precise clock signals for accurate data acquisition, signal generation, and timebase references.
In industrial automation, SI5350C-B01863-GT is utilized for synchronizing processes, controlling timing sequences, and coordinating various components in complex systems.
SI5350C-B01863-GT finds applications in consumer electronics such as smart TVs, gaming consoles, and audio/video equipment, where it ensures accurate timing for seamless operation.
